ue to the nature of research, manufacturing, and production, working in the pharma industry demands skilled engineers who understand how to ensure the energy and HVAC systems operate in a manner that meets with federal regulations, global standards, and public expectations. ENERActive Solutions is an industry leader in working in this critical environment and holds the necessary expertise to work with facility teams to develop tailored energy conservation programs. Founded in 2006, ENERActive Solutions is an independent, energy consulting and project development firm specializing in the analysis, development, and implementation of energy conservation projects. Headquartered in Asbury Park, New Jersey, with regional offices in Boston, New York City, Chicago, Philadelphia, Beltsville, Maryland, and Harrisonburg, Virginia, Eneractive brings real energy savings and performance enhancement to clients both nationwide and internationally. This reflects our conviction that great projects cannot happen without passion, intelligence, and personal commitment, which is demonstrated by our portfolio of work. Eneractive leverages both traditional demand side strategies and newly available supply side initiatives to ensure optimum facility performance and lower operating costs. Our experience ranges from large-scale power generation to traditional building and energy systems. Our solutions focus on the domains of building HVAC and controls, new energy technologies,renewable energy, power plant environmental systems (SCR), and energy awareness and education. Through our core services, we are able to work with our clients and develop projects that are thoughtful, prudent, and valuable in their cost effectiveness, as well as their appropriateness with the long range planning for facilities and operations.

PFIZER WORLD HEADQUARTERS

ASHRAE LEVEL II ENERGY AUDIT & RETRO-CX Manhattan, NYC

• OVER 27 ECMS IDENTIFIED FOR IMPLEMENTATION • $966,599 SAVINGS IN ANNUAL UTILITY EXPENSES • 21% REDUCTION IN ANNUAL UTILITY COSTS COMPARED TO BASELINE UTILITY TOTALS • ESTIMATED SAVINGS OF 1,593,967 KWH AND 21,055 MLBS OF STEAM ANNUALLY • PAYBACK PERIOD OF 4.1 YEARS

JOHNSON & JOHNSON Retro-Commissioning Projects

HORSHAM, PA

ENERActive was contracted to perform a detailed retro-cx study on 3 buildings in the Johnson & Johnson Horsham, PA campus.

• Over 291,000 square feet assessed • Implementation of measures would equate to 894,184 kWh of electricity and 7,791 therms of natural gas in annual energy savings

GLAXOSMITHKLINE

Clifton, NJ

PROPOSED A

Solar Consulting

350 kWdc

ROOFTOP SOLAR SYSTEM

Eneractive assessed the solar opportunity in the form of a solar study for the GlaxoSmithKline facility located in Clifton, New Jersey. A full assessment of the structural capacity was performed to determine that the building could support the additional load required by the photovoltaic system. Multiple financing options were provided to allow GlaxoSmithKline to make a fully informed decision on the opportunity.
